What does the future look like for HIV?

Introducing HIV: The Long View

As little as three decades ago, there was no such thing as a long-term vision for people living with HIV. Now, thanks to the collaborative work of the entire HIV community, the life expectancy of people living with HIV today is approaching that of the general population.[i] Looking forward to the next twenty years, there’s no doubt that the overall healthcare landscape is going to change significantly. But what could this changing environment mean for the future of HIV treatment, prevention and care?

The European AIDS Treatment Group (EATG) would like to invite you to an online webinar to discuss the launch of theHIV: The Long View report, which envisions the potential long-term future of HIV in the context of the changing healthcare landscape.
